Quote:
Originally Posted by rdjones
I thought people where able to transfer there entries to other cars, in the case of Prodrive I thought they might have used there entry for one of the Aston's .
Entrants can certainly change car type but ACO are reserving judgement and not automatically giving the Aston an entry until they've seen the cars perform at Sebring.

"The Selection Committee will see the DBR9s racing for the first time on 19th March in the Sebring 12 Hours"

Sensible, really - if the Aston's were to turn out to be dogs ACO would look a bit silly having accepted a "blind" entry.

Another thing...

Note that the BMS Ferrari 550 is accepted, this is not the Prodrive pre-selected entry it is a pre-selection for BMS winning the FIA GT. This sort of crept into the regs at some point!

Prodrive preselection is presumably "on hold" pending the Aston's performance at Sebring.
